British teen jailed in Dubai after having sex with girl on holiday

After engaging in ‘vacation romance’ with a 17-year-old female, an 18-year-old British man was imprisoned.

Marcus Fakana, a London resident who was on vacation in the United Arab Emirates with his family, was given a one-year prison sentence.

He also thinks the 17-year-old, whom he met at his hotel, is from London.

‘Detained in Dubai’ is an advocacy group that claims the kid feels ‘abandoned’ by the British authorities.

In a statement, Fakana’s family requested that Foreign Secretary David Lammy step in.

Last month, Detained in Dubai’s CEO, Radha Sterling, stated: “Mr. Lammy is in a perfect position to help young Marcus.”

“Dubai police have the authority to allow Marcus to return home and drop the case against him. We ask Mr. Lammy MP to communicate this to his peers in the United Arab Emirates because we do not want to do this to young people.

According to reports, Fakana described the experience to Sterling: “We had a great time together. Although we had a lot in common, she kept her family secrets since they were strict.

“My parents were aware of our relationship, but she was unable to disclose her own. Mr. Fakana told Detained in Dubai, “She had to meet me without telling them it was to see a boy.”

I was eager to see her again when I returned home after she departed. Then our hotel door was abruptly knocked on by police. They refused to explain why they were hauling me in for interrogation. I had no idea what it was for. My parents were scared, and I was scared.

Although out-of-wedlock sex for visitors is now legal in Dubai, the city nevertheless adheres to stringent Islamic law.

Sterling, who was helping Fakana and his family, stated: “After his girlfriend returned to London, he was informed that her mother had reported the connection to the police in Dubai.

“Marcus later learned that the mother had discovered their conversations and photos on her daughter’s phone. She was so incensed that she called the Dubai police to report him.

Involving the police in a private problem that is quite lawful in the nation where she resides and where the children have grown up, this mother is obviously very rigid.

“Perhaps she wasn’t aware that she triggered the possibility of a young man of only 18 spending the next 20 years in prison.”

Fakana was given a sentence of one year in prison, while he was previously facing a maximum of twenty years.

Ms. Sterling continued, “At the time, Marcus was unaware that the girl was only a few months younger than him. There is no need for Dubai to pursue this.

“Parents will be afraid to take their older teens on vacation with them because they might die for actions that are totally acceptable in their home countries.”

It is anticipated that Fakana would challenge his sentence.
